Features Skyfire / 天火危情 Shanghai Fortress / 上海堡垒 Boogie The Modelizer We Are Living Things Big Fan English Vinglish #Lucky Number Entre Nos Zenith Anna May Wong, “In Her Own Words” Other Projects Episodics View Work Commercials / Music Videos View Work Illustrations View Work